采用单次快拍数据实现信源DOA估计

摘    要:针对均匀线性阵列DOA估计中的实时性和解相干问题,提出了一种基于单次快拍数据的估计算法,通过对阵列接收的单次快拍数据进行相关处理后重构Toeplitz矩阵,并证明该矩阵的秩不受信号相干性的影响。通过特征值分解,得到对应的信号子空间和噪声子空间,结合MUSIC算法和ESPRIT算法实现了对相干和非相干信号的DOA估计。算法不损失阵列孔径,具有更好的实时性和抗噪声干扰的能力;在低信噪比条件下,仍具有较好的估计性能。最后计算机仿真结果证实了算法的有效性和可行性。

关 键 词:DOA估计  单次快拍  矩阵重构  Toeplitz矩阵

DOA Estimation of Signals Using one Snapshot

Abstract:A new algorithm based on one single snapshot is proposed for the instantaneity and decorrelation problems among Direction-Of-Arrival (DOA) estimation of signals on a ULA, which reconstructs a Toeplitz matrix using the correlation processed data vector. It is proved that the rank of this Toeplitz matrix has no relations with the coherency of the signals. Then accurate signal subspace and noise subspace can be acquired by performing eigenvalue decomposition of the matrix and the DOA of coherent and incoherent signals can be estimated combined with the subspace kind algorithms such as MUSIC and ESPRIT. This algorithm, without reducing the aperture of array, enhances the performances of DOA estimation under low SNR condition. Simulation results verify that the proposed algorithm is effective.
